David Watkin’s " Storia dell'architettura occidentale " (A History of Western Architecture) is a definitive academic manual known for its focus on the Classical tradition as a living language of continuity.
3. Critique of Modernism Watkin is famous for his independence of thought. In the later chapters (often the most debated parts of the book), he offers a pointed critique of the Modern Movement. He does not blindly worship Le Corbusier or Mies van der Rohe; instead, he analyzes the failures of urban planning in the mid-20th century.
